Sourcing guidance for Magnetic Strip
What are the key technical specifications to consider when sourcing magnetic strips for industrial or retail use?
Buyers must prioritize the Magnetic Grade (e.g., Y30, Y35 for Ferrite or N35-N52 for Neodymium) to ensure the holding force meets application requirements. For flexible strips, the thickness (typically 0.5mm to 5mm) directly correlates with magnetic strength. Additionally, specify the adhesive backing type (e.g., 3M 9448, VHB, or standard acrylic) to ensure compatibility with the mounting surface, whether it be metal, plastic, or wood.
How do I ensure the magnetic strips comply with international safety and environmental standards?
It is critical to verify that the products are RoHS (Restriction of Hazardous Substances) and REACH compliant, ensuring they are free from lead, cadmium, and mercury. For products intended for the toy or educational market, ensure they meet EN71 or ASTM F963 standards. Always request MSDS (Material Safety Data Sheets) from the supplier to confirm chemical stability and safety during transport.
What performance benchmarks should be validated before placing a bulk order?
Request a Pull Strength Test report to verify the vertical holding power per square inch. For outdoor applications, confirm UV resistance and temperature stability (typically -20°C to 80°C) to prevent the strip from becoming brittle or losing magnetism. For flexible magnets, a flexibility test should be conducted to ensure the material does not crack when wrapped around a specific radius.
How can I optimize cost-efficiency when purchasing magnetic strips in large volumes?
To reduce costs, consider ordering in jumbo rolls rather than pre-cut pieces if you have conversion capabilities in-house. Leverage volume-based pricing tiers, where discounts of 15-25% are common for orders exceeding 5,000 meters. Additionally, choosing Anisotropic magnets over Isotropic ones provides better performance-to-cost ratios for directional holding tasks.
Cross-Border Procurement Strategy for Magnetic Strips
What are the specific shipping risks and regulations for magnetic materials?
Magnets are classified as 'Dangerous Goods' for air freight if their magnetic field strength exceeds 0.159 A/m at a distance of 2.1m. You must ensure the supplier provides Magnetic Shielding Packaging (using iron sheets) and a Non-Dangerous Goods Appraisal Report to avoid customs delays or rejection by airlines. For sea freight, this is less restrictive but requires moisture-proof vacuum packaging to prevent oxidation.
How should I negotiate quality assurance terms with suppliers on Made-in-China.com?
Always insist on a pre-shipment inspection (PSI) by a third party like SGS or Intertek. Define a tolerance level for dimensions (e.g., ±0.05mm) and magnetic flux in the contract. Use Trade Assurance services provided by the platform to ensure that payment is only released once the quality matches the agreed-upon samples.
What are the common pitfalls in magnetic strip sourcing and how to avoid them?
A common risk is 'Magnetic Decay' caused by low-quality raw materials. Avoid suppliers offering prices significantly below market average, as they may use recycled magnetic powder. Ensure the contract specifies 100% virgin material. Another pitfall is adhesive failure; always request a shelf-life guarantee for the adhesive backing, typically at least 12 months under proper storage conditions.
